Re: installing pulse secure but error: rolling back ended prematurely

Enable MSI logging using /l*vx switch and replicate the issue.

Open the MSI log file and search/fold using the search string "Entrypoint" (without quotes/match case), which will help you to identify the specific install action which is failing, then review the possible causes for the failure.

Re: installing pulse secure but error: rolling back ended prematurely

Hi @JoseA,

 

Based on the logs, it seems that the network driver installation is failing (JNPRNS - Juniper Network Service).

 

"DIFXAPP: ERROR: Error 0x8007007E encountered while installing the inf 'C:\WINDOWS\system32\DRVSTORE\jnprns_260C6334D987C71B41EC39304CE4AE75D6794E54\jnprns.inf'. Unable to install network component 'jnprns'"

 

Are you using Windows 10 - 1607 build? Found this KB article: https://kb.pulsesecure.net/articles/Pulse_Secure_Article/KB40952
